Jewish Theological Seminary Outreach Weekend takes place from 7 p.m. Friday, Jan. 18 to 1 p.m. Saturday, Jan. 19, at Temple Beth Sholom. Dr. David Roskies, professor of Jewish Literature at the Jewish Theological Seminary, will speak on “The Making of the Modern Jewish Memory.” Dr. Roskies is an author, Jewish literature professor and cultural historian of eastern European Jewry. During Friday night services, which start at 7 p.m. Friday, Jan. 18, he will be speaking about “Covenantal Memory: How Jews Remember.” During his presentation during Saturday services, which start at at 9 a.m., he will discuss “In Wartime: When the Cannons Roar, the Muses are Never Silent." At 12:30 pm, Dr. Roskies will discuss “Reading in Time: A Holocaust Curriculum for Conservative Jews.”

Community members joined hands Saturday, May 18 on Siesta Key beach as a symbol of their support for the protection of coastal economies, oceans, marine wildlife and fisheries. Supporters voiced their concern about damage that happens due to offshore oil drilling accidents, hydraulic fracturing, the Alberta tar sands, mountain top removal mining, and about coal fired power plants. Forty-two people joined hands for the Hands Across the Sand national movement. -
